How can organizations ensure that the culture of transparency and collaboration is sustained long-term, and what strategies can be implemented to continuously improve and adapt to meet the evolving needs of employees and the organization as a whole?
Organizations can ensure that the culture of transparency and collaboration is sustained long-term by consistently communicating openly with employees, fostering trust through leadership transparency, and encouraging feedback and open dialogue. Strategies such as regular town hall meetings, transparent decision-making processes, and creating a culture of continuous learning and growth can help improve and adapt to meet the evolving needs of employees and the organization as a whole. Additionally, implementing feedback mechanisms, conducting regular surveys, and actively listening to employee concerns can help identify areas for improvement and drive positive change within the organization.
